Build high performance web apps and APIs

Our Elixir and Phoenix training course aims to give developers an intensive journey through obtaining the tools and platform, understanding the Elixir language, and building their first Phoenix framework application.

Elixir is a new functional language which runs on the Erlang VM (in much the same way that Scala runs on the Java VM). The Erlang VM itself is lightning fast and is especially well suited to scaling up massively due to its capacity for parallelisation / concurrency.

Coupled with the Phoenix framework, you can build super-efficient high-performance web apps and APIs which reduce the need for extensive and expensive server hardware - but if you do need to ramp things up, it has fantastic support for Docker containerisation, making deployment and scaling up your system a breeze.

"The charismatic trainer kept the audience's attention."

Secure Web App Development Training Course
JW, Business Analyst
Jato

"The instructor went into great detail of the language (Python) and his amazing understanding of other languages made for great contrasting examples which made it easy to understand."

Python Training Course
Anonymous, Senior Test Analyst
BBC

"Richard was a great instructor, thanks so much for your efforts! I'm so much more confident with Visual Studio and C# coding."

.NET Programming with C# Training Course
SO, Software Engineer
UTC Aerospace

"Having a small class size meant plenty of opportunity to talk about my particular issues with .NET and C#. The instructor was able to explain everything extremely well. His efforts were much appreciated – I learned a huge amount during the course."

.NET Programming with C# Training Course
SP, Web Developer
Charity Commision

"Great interactive training course. Fantastic to hear other experiences and formalise the Scrum framework and Product Owner role."

Professional Scrum Product Owner™ (PSPO) Training Course
RB, Product Owner
Audatex

"I, along with three colleagues, came on the Agile course. The training was fantastic. I have limited Agile knowledge and this helped answer all the questions I had, in an impartial and helpful way. I learned more about Scrum than I have done in the past and heard of different frameworks that I didn’t know existed and much of this was down to the instructor: his approach, style and knowledge. Please pass on my thanks and I cannot recommend Framework highly enough based on this session."

Agile Project Management Training Course
DS, Programme Manager
Technophobia

"The course ran with a nice small class size. It was good to be able to use my own machine during the training. I was able to do some additional work in the evenings during the course and take the practical elements with me after the course had completed. "

Windows Presentation Foundation 4.5 (WPF) Training Course
DS, Developer
Mitsubishi UFJ

"The content was useful and the course was delivered at a good level of difficulty."

Python Training Course
SH, Developer
Winton Capital

"The course was delivered by a very enthusiastic and knowledgeable instructor who was able to draw on his real-world experience during the training."

ECMAScript 6 Training Course - ES6 Training
MH, Front-end Developer
Ordnance Survey

"Excellent discussions [...] It was a please to have a knowledgeable and friendly expert as instructor. The course exceeded my expectation and gave me lots to think about."

Microservices with Docker Training Course
VV, Principal Software Engineer
Virtual Instruments

Get in touch

We would love to hear from you if you have any questions about your training needs.

or call us on 020 3137 3920